THERE was bumper entries on Good Friday at the Tipperary Area IPS Working Hunter Show which also offered a last chance to qualify for the Northern Ireland Festival.

Held at Tipperary Equestrian Centre, the classes were run in the amazing new outdoor arena which was installed earlier this year. With competitors traveling from as far as Galway and Kerry, all classes were very busy and were efficiently judged by Mary Moore. Ponies and riders were given a fair but challenging track designed by Tomas Ryan.
